#CardanoDebate: The Community Decides the Future of $100 Million and the spirit of its DeFi Ecosystem

La Victoria, Aragua, Venezuela – June 14, 2025 –

A heated debate, under the banner of the hashtag #CardanoDebate, has shaken the foundations of the Cardano community, causing a drop of over 6% in the price of ADA and testing its highly anticipated decentralized governance model. At the center of the storm is a bold proposal: inject 140 million ADA (approximately $100 million USD) from the community treasury to catalyze liquidity in its growing Decentralized Finance (DeFi) sector.

This is not just any debate; it is a real-time litmus test for Cardano's Voltaire era, a decisive moment that could define its competitiveness in the fierce battlefield of DeFi.

The discussion, initiated by the analysis platform TapTools, goes far beyond a simple allocation of funds. It touches the fundamental fiber of Cardano's philosophy: Should the treasury, funded by the community itself, be used proactively and aggressively to compete, or should it be maintained as a conservative strategic reserve?

Here we break down the key information and context you need to understand the magnitude of this event:

1. The Goal: Solve the "Cold Start Problem" of DeFi

* The Problem: Every DeFi ecosystem needs deep liquidity to function. Without it, exchanges suffer from high slippage, lending is inefficient, and user experience is poor. Cardano, despite its robust technology, faces the classic "cold start problem": it needs liquidity to attract users, but it needs users to create liquidity.

* The Proposed Solution: The injection of $100 million ADA from the treasury seeks to be the catalyst. These funds would be allocated to provide liquidity to native stablecoins of the ecosystem, such as Mehen's USDM, and other key pairs on Cardano's decentralized exchanges (DEXs). This would make transactions cheaper and more efficient, attracting developers and capital from other ecosystems.

2. Charles Hoskinson's Position: A Vision of Strategy and Survival

The intervention of Cardano's founder, Charles Hoskinson, has added more fuel to the fire. His defense of the proposal is not just support but a call for strategic action. Hoskinson argues that:

* Inaction is a Risk: Waiting for liquidity to grow organically could be too slow, allowing competitors like Ethereum, Solana, and others to gain an insurmountable foothold.

* The Treasury is a Tool, not a Museum: It argues that the treasury of Cardano exists precisely for these types of strategic initiatives that drive ecosystem growth.

* Diversification of the Treasury: Hoskinson went further, suggesting that the treasury should not only spend ADA but also diversify a portion of its holdings into other crypto assets, such as Bitcoin (BTC). This idea, while secondary to the main debate, points to a more sophisticated treasury management to protect its long-term value against the volatility of a single asset.

3. The Debate Arguments: Growth vs. Risk

The community is divided, and both sides have valid arguments that reflect the central tension of the decentralized world.

| In Favor of the Proposal (The "Pro-Growth" Camp) | Against the Proposal (The "Pro-Care" Camp) |

|---|---|

| Acceleration of the Ecosystem: It would be the adrenaline injection that Cardano's DeFi needs to compete in the big leagues. | Selling Pressure on ADA: Converting 140 million ADA to stablecoins could generate massive selling pressure, affecting the price in the short and medium term. |

| Increase in ADA Utility: A vibrant DeFi ecosystem creates more use cases and demand for the ADA token. | Risk of Centralization: Who would manage these funds? The selection of a "committee" could be seen as a form of centralization, contrary to the spirit of Cardano. |

| Trust Signal: It would demonstrate that Cardano is willing to invest in itself, attracting major investors and builders. | Moral Hazard and Precedent: It could create the expectation that the treasury will rescue or fund projects, rather than these competing on their own merits. It opens the door to future controversial proposals. |

| Competitiveness: It is a necessary measure to avoid falling behind in a race where liquidity is queen. | Is it the Best Use?: Some argue that those funds could be allocated to other developments, research, or improvements to the core protocol. |

4. The Market Impact: Uncertainty Converted into Numbers

The market reaction has been immediate. The drop in ADA to seek support in the $0.60 area is not only a reaction to macroeconomic volatility but a clear manifestation of the uncertainty this debate generates. Investors are weighing the promise of a stronger DeFi ecosystem against the immediate risk of selling pressure and questions about governance.
